Fearing Allah

Al-Sheikh Nasir Al-Din Al-Tusi defined fear as an emotional pain that occurs because of anticipating something bad or expecting something good to go away. Therefor the fear of Allah (swt) is an emotional pain that occurs because of anticipating the punishment or expectation of losing out in the rewards of Allah for the sins and wicked actions that the person committed or desires to commit.

One of the many characteristics indorsed and sought after by Islam for Muslims to have, as available in the holy Quran and sayings the prophet's progeny (peace be upon them) is the fear of Allah (swt). As it can be seen in the verse “But as for he who feared the position of his Lord and prevented the soul from [unlawful] inclination, then indeed, Paradise will be [his] refuge.” Allah (swt) is praising those who feared him and acted according to that fear that they will enter heaven. In another verse, Allah (swt) states, “So fear them not, but fear Me, if you are [indeed] believers” and asserts that a true believer fears Allah (swt). The prophet's progeny (peace be upon them) were known for their fear of Allah (swt) and they ordered their followers to have this fear as well. Imam Al-Sadiq (peace br upon him) stated, “Fear Allah (swt) as if you see him, and if you cannot see him he can see you. If you believe he cannot see you then you are a disbeliever”If you believed that he can see you and yet showed yourself sinning before him then you have made him the least important witness.” He also stated, “The believer is between two fears: a past sin that he does not know how Allah (swt) dealt with and a life span in which he does not know what wicked action he might commit. He therefore remains in fear and nothing is better for him than fear.”

An important fact that one should take into consideration is that there has to be balance in fear, not too much to the point where it reaches to despair, nor should it be too little so that it reaches to neglecting Allah (swt) and his plans.
